"Clean, quiet, well kept, with a crew of workers trying to keep it in a good shape. It has some free user-powered exercise tools installed at strategic distances. Eventually, you will find yoga practitioners, aerobic dancers, fitness groups, cyclists, no idea on how membership works for them. You can just walk alone, or with family/friends, as exercise, social, or recreational activity. You can watch, from time to time, wild parrots, see cranes, squirrels, and even domestic happy chicken running free in the area. It has a cross-fit dog training area. Nice place to relax surrounded by trees crossed above by a high traffic and another medium traffic avenue bridges, some trees are really big and old, some are young."

🚇 🗺️ Getting There
You can reach the park using public transportation from Monterrey. Several TikTok videos demonstrate routes involving the Metro and Metrobús. For instance, one method involves taking the Metro to the Félix U. Gómez station and then transferring to a specific Metrobús line.
While specific parking details aren't extensively covered, the park is accessible by public transport, suggesting it's a viable option for those without personal vehicles.
Public transport is a recommended option. Look for routes that connect from central Monterrey, potentially involving the Metro system and then a bus connection.
